Output 6616cfc51e663a903d2d572a853c4b44ea0707361fd0b9c8e6b38cbd2024d887:2

value
40639393
script pubkey
OP_HASH160 OP_PUSHBYTES_20 733cf22283e4dc158a9275cfc203a0e03f918f4d OP_EQUAL
address
MJQUx5hXNyzuLP4JtqZXykAaMp8FT4o3Vg
transaction
6616cfc51e663a903d2d572a853c4b44ea0707361fd0b9c8e6b38cbd2024d887
spent
true